Our client, a leading global financial institution, is seeking an experienced Sales & Trading Lawyer to join their EMEA Legal Division in London. This position provides transactional and regulatory legal coverage for the firm's Sales & Trading businesses, encompassing both Fixed Income and Institutional Equities.
You will be part of a highly collaborative Legal & Compliance function that advises the business on a wide range of complex, cross-border issues, including derivatives, structured products, and regulatory change initiatives.
Key Responsibilities:
Provide legal advice on bespoke transactions and template documentation, terms of business, and regulatory disclosures.
Advise on new product development for EMEA distribution, ensuring robust management of legal and reputational risk.
Interpret and advise on the impact of new and existing UK and EU regulations, including MiFID II (pre- and post-trade reporting, systematic internaliser regimes, etc.).
Partner with Technology, Operations, Compliance, and Business Control Units to implement regulatory change projects.
Represent the firm in industry forums, roundtables, and regulatory consultations.
Skills & Experience Required:
Minimum 7 years' PQE, ideally gained within a top-tier law firm and/or the legal department of a major financial institution.
Expertise in OTC derivatives (across equities, credit, rates, or FX) and/or securitised derivatives (e.g., CLNs, retail structured products).
Strong understanding of MiFID II and other relevant UK and EU regulatory frameworks.
Demonstrated ability to advise Sales & Trading businesses and interpret complex regulations pragmatically.
Excellent communication skills and ability to work cross-functionally across multiple jurisdictions.
Qualified lawyer (England & Wales preferred).
